Bolton is a Greater Manchester town with a significant post-industrial heritage in cotton spinning and textiles, significant areas of deprivation alongside more prosperous suburban communities, and a diverse population including large South Asian Muslim communities, creating demand for culturally competent and faith-sensitive mental health care. NHS mental health services are delivered through Greater Manchester Mental Health NHS Foundation Trust, and a private therapy sector supplements provision for those who can access it. the University of Greater Manchester (formerly the University of Bolton) brings a student population and some counselling capacity, and the town's proximity to Manchester gives residents access to a broader range of private therapy services. Common therapy concerns include economic stress, anxiety, depression, and the identity and community belonging challenges faced across a diverse and economically varied population.
